I'm having trouble building this library (segfault) on an M1 box w/Docker desktop for macos with linux/amd64 as target. Arm builds fine.
docker buildx build --rm --provenance=false --platform=linux/amd64 -t nodeaws:1 -f Dockerfile . --load
FROM ubuntu:22.04 RUN mkdir -p /app WORKDIR /app RUN apt-get update \ && apt-get install -y --no-install-recommends \ build-essential \ gpg-agent \ software-properties-common \ curl \ cmake \ autoconf \ libtool \ automake \ tar \ gzip \ libexecs-dev \ libkrb5-dev \ libcurl4-openssl-dev \ libssl-dev \ autotools-dev \ libpsl-dev \ libgsasl-dev \ libssl-dev \ libidn2-dev \ zlib1g-dev \ python3-pip \ python3-setuptools \ python3 \ g++ \ unzip RUN curl -fsSL https://deb.nodesource.com/setup_18.x | bash - && apt-get install -y nodejs RUN npm install --global aws-lambda-ric
The issue seems to be with compiling curl. Could a pre-installed curl be used, if available?
#0 525.2 npm ERR! code 2 #0 525.2 npm ERR! path /usr/lib/node_modules/aws-lambda-ric #0 525.2 npm ERR! command failed #0 525.2 npm ERR! command sh -c ./scripts/preinstall.sh ... #0 525.3 npm ERR! gcc: internal compiler error: Segmentation fault signal terminated program cc1 #0 525.3 npm ERR! Please submit a full bug report, #0 525.3 npm ERR! with preprocessed source if appropriate. #0 525.3 npm ERR! See <file:///usr/share/doc/gcc-11/README.Bugs> for instructions. #0 525.3 npm ERR! make[2]: *** [Makefile:2057: libcurl_la-cookie.lo] Error 1 #0 525.3 npm ERR! make[1]: *** [Makefile:1355: all] Error 2 #0 525.3 npm ERR! make: *** [Makefile:1229: all-recursive] Error 1
